The Cardiff Stage at the Millennium Stadium - SS13
Run for the first time last year, this short stage takes place within the Millennium Stadium. Fifth Gear presenters, Tiff Needell and Vicki Butler-Henderson will host this year's MPH '06 Rally Challenge, a unique evening of cars, noise and celebrities. WRC cars will burst into the stadium to complete the final stage of the day, before the hour of automotive hilarity begins, with teams of guest drivers battling it out for pole position in an 'It's a Knock Out' meets 'Gladiators' series of thrills and spills. The action will conclude with the rest of the Rally convoy entering the impressive arena at high speed and completing the figure of eight course. Doors open at 4pm. Show starts at 5.00pm. Facilities: disabled, catering, big screens, PA / commentary, trade stands / merchandise
The last car is expected at approximately 21:45.
All seats are pre-allocated
No readmission
Please look after your ticket as a duplicate will not be issued
All children must be accompanied by an adult
Children are classified as aged 15 and less
Babies in arms go free
No single person supplement
Max number of tickets per transaction 12
One programme per adult ticket to be collected from the collection points at the Millennium Stadium
It is not possible to ensure that tickets bought at different times and by different people within a group will be seated together
No exchanges
No refunds will be issued for any stages that are cancelled, whether in advance or on the day. Refunds equivalent to the price of the ticket and processing fees, excluding postage, will only be issued if the entire event is cancelled.
